GLUTEN-FREE CHEESY CIABATTA ROLLS

A great gluten-free dinner roll that can be put together in no time. If you're going to get in to gluten-free baking, tapioca flour is going to be one of your best friends. It has great texture and weight, making a fantastic wheat substitute. In this recipe notice we don't even need a binding agent like xanthan gum? That's the beauty of using cheese!

Time 30m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 6

2 eggs
¼ teaspoon sea salt, or more to taste
2 cups finely shredded mozzarella cheese
1 cup tapioca flour, plus more for dusting
1 tablespoon baking powder
2 tablespoons milk, or as needed

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  • Whisk eggs and salt together in a large bowl with a fork. Stir in mozzarella cheese. Sift tapioca flour and baking powder together over cheese mixture; mix well until cheese softens into the eggs and flour. Add enough milk to make a moist, slightly crumbly dough.
  • Dust your work surface with tapioca flour. Scrape dough out of the bowl and knead gently until it begins to feel smooth, about 3 minutes. Shape dough into a log; divide into 4 equal pieces. Carefully roll the pieces of dough under your cupped fingers until round. Transfer to the lined baking sheet.
  • Bake rolls in the preheated oven until golden, 15 to 20 minutes.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 301.5 calories, Carbohydrate 31.9 g, Cholesterol 129.8 mg, Fat 11.7 g, Protein 17.3 g, SaturatedFat 6.6 g, Sodium 864.9 mg, Sugar 1.2 g
